Agenda / Modules

Module 1: Delivery foundations

  • what good project or agile delivery looks like in practice
  • roles, principles, and expectations
  • choosing the right level of structure for the work

Module 2: Planning, scope, and priorities

  • scope, priorities, backlog, milestones, or work breakdown
  • estimating and sequencing more realistically
  • making dependencies and ownership visible

Module 3: Roles, ceremonies, or governance

  • team roles, meetings, reviews, or governance checkpoints
  • keeping communication disciplined and useful
  • reducing drift and confusion as work progresses

Module 4: Risk, communication, and tracking

  • tracking progress, issues, and risks
  • communicating status and escalation clearly
  • responding constructively to change, blockers, or variance

Module 5: Continuous improvement

  • retrospectives, lessons learned, and process refinement
  • turning delivery experience into better practice
  • planning immediate improvements after the course
